Under the DPDP Act, 2023, who is responsible for
determining the purpose and means of processing personal data?Solution
Explanation: The Data Fiduciary is defined under the DPDP Act, 2023 as the person (or entity) who determines the purpose and means of processing personal data. This is similar to the concept of a "data controller" in international laws like the GDPR. The Data Processor , in contrast, processes data on behalf of the Data Fiduciary. The Data Principal is the individual to whom the personal data relates.
